什么网站程序适合做seo,加强官网建设,网站建设丶金手指花总11,公司的网站链接找谁做MySQL 的 SQL 操作可以分为几个主要类别#xff0c;每个类别包含了一系列的语句#xff0c;用于执行不同的数据库操作#xff1a;
数据查询语言#xff08;DQL#xff09;
SELECT#xff1a;用于从一个或多个表中检索数据。可以使用 WHERE 子句进行条件筛选#xff0c…MySQL 的 SQL 操作可以分为几个主要类别每个类别包含了一系列的语句用于执行不同的数据库操作
数据查询语言DQL
SELECT用于从一个或多个表中检索数据。可以使用 WHERE 子句进行条件筛选GROUP BY 子句进行分组HAVING 子句对分组结果进行筛选ORDER BY 子句对结果进行排序等。
数据操纵语言DML
INSERT用于向表中插入新的行。UPDATE用于更新表中的现有数据。DELETE用于从表中删除数据。
数据定义语言DDL
CREATE用于创建新的数据库对象如数据库、表、索引、视图等。ALTER用于修改现有数据库对象的结构如添加或删除表的列、修改表的约束等。DROP用于删除数据库对象如删除表、数据库、索引等。TRUNCATE用于快速删除表中的所有行但保留表结构。
数据控制语言DCL
GRANT用于授予用户或角色特定的权限。REVOKE用于撤销用户或角色的权限。
事务控制语言TCL
BEGIN 或 START TRANSACTION用于开始一个新的事务。COMMIT用于提交当前事务使事务中的所有更改成为数据库的一部分。ROLLBACK用于回滚当前事务撤销事务中的所有更改。SAVEPOINT用于在事务中设置保存点允许部分回滚。
其他 SQL 语句
SHOW用于显示数据库、表、索引等的列表或信息。DESCRIBE 或 DESC用于显示表的结构包括列的名称、数据类型等信息。USE用于选择当前要操作的数据库。EXPLAIN用于获取 SQL 语句的执行计划信息。
这些 SQL 操作构成了 MySQL 数据库管理的基础使用户能够有效地创建、查询、更新和管理数据库中的数据。